About TBN Tiling & Stone
Rez (Reza) leads TBN Tiling & Stone and is the name customers mention repeatedly — he handles everything from full bathroom renovations and kitchen floor rip-outs to laundry tiling and splashbacks, and reviews suggest he brings the same precision to a small backsplash as he does to a whole-home multi-room project. What sets him apart from many tiling contractors is his hands-on involvement even after the job wraps — one customer notes he returned to help mount a wall cabinet, a level of follow-through that goes beyond the tile itself. Customers most often highlight his cleanliness on site: daily cleanup before leaving is a pattern that comes up across multiple reviews, making him a practical choice if you're living in the home during renovation. He works primarily in the residential space — bathrooms, ensuites, kitchens, laundries, and toilets — and reviews suggest he's comfortable managing full scope including demolition, benchtop supply and install, and layout decisions like relocating vanities and showers. A tile shop has recommended him directly to their customers, which points to trade-level credibility rather than just consumer word-of-mouth. Operating as a registered company for close to five years and GST-registered, TBN suits homeowners who want a tiler who can coordinate a full wet-area renovation rather than just lay tiles on a prepared surface.
Best for: full bathroom or ensuite renovations requiring demolition and full tiling, multi-room tiling projects across kitchens, laundries and bathrooms, and homeowners who need a tiler comfortable coordinating scope beyond just laying tiles.

What types of tiling jobs does TBN Tiling & Stone take on?+
Reviews show TBN handles full wet-area renovations rather than isolated tile repairs — bathrooms, ensuites, kitchens, laundries, and toilets are all mentioned. Rez and his team have tackled jobs ranging from small splashbacks to complete bathroom overhauls including demolition, ceiling work, and vanity relocation. They also supply and install benchtops as part of laundry and kitchen renovations, so the scope often extends beyond just the tiles themselves.
Is TBN Tiling & Stone owner-operated or a larger crew?+
Rez (Reza) is the hands-on operator and the name that appears in virtually every review — customers speak to him directly for quotes and he's present throughout the job. He works with a small team, which means you're getting the person who quoted you actually doing the work. One reviewer notes a relationship spanning around 10 years with Rez personally, suggesting continuity of the same operator over time.
What do customers say about pricing at TBN Tiling & Stone?+
A couple of reviewers specifically call out the pricing as fair and reasonable — one laundry renovation customer noted the job was done "very professionally" with "very fair and reasonable" pricing. Another customer who came in via a tile shop referral described the quote as "fairly priced." Reviews don't flag any pricing concerns, but as always it's worth getting a written quote before work begins.
How does TBN handle site cleanliness during a renovation?+
Daily cleanup before leaving the site is a pattern mentioned independently by multiple customers — one review specifically notes "the demo was done clean and they cleaned any mess every day before they left." This is worth noting if you're living in the home during the renovation, as bathroom and kitchen jobs generate significant dust and debris. The "no mess, no fuss" description appears across several reviews from different customers.
Does TBN Tiling & Stone do work for other trades or builders, or just homeowners directly?+
Both — at least one reviewer identifies as a trade professional who uses Rez for client projects, and a tile shop has referred him directly to their retail customers. This trade-level endorsement suggests he's comfortable meeting the finish standards that professional clients require. For homeowners, this means you're hiring someone whose work is regularly assessed by industry peers, not just end users.
